excel怎么带负号

excel怎么带负号

在Excel中添加负号的方法包括:直接输入负数、使用公式、通过自定义格式、应用条件格式等。 直接输入负数是最简单的方法,但如果需要批量处理数据,使用公式、自定义格式和条件格式会更加高效。下面将详细介绍这几种方法。

一、直接输入负数

在Excel中,最直观的方法就是直接输入带有负号的数据。例如,您可以在一个单元格中直接输入“-100”来表示负数。这种方法适用于少量数据的输入。

二、使用公式

如果需要批量处理数据,可以使用公式来快速添加负号。假设您有一个数据列,需要将这些数据都转换为负数,可以使用以下公式:

=-A1

将此公式应用于目标单元格后,拖动填充柄将公式复制到其他单元格。

应用公式的步骤:

  1. 在目标单元格中输入公式 =-A1
  2. 按回车键。
  3. 将鼠标悬停在目标单元格的右下角,出现填充柄。
  4. 拖动填充柄,将公式复制到所需的单元格。

三、自定义格式

自定义格式可以帮助您在不改变实际值的情况下显示负号。以下是设置自定义格式的步骤:

  1. 选中需要添加负号的单元格或区域。
  2. 右键单击选择“设置单元格格式”。
  3. 在弹出的对话框中,选择“数字”选项卡。
  4. 选择“自定义”。
  5. 在“类型”框中输入 -0-0.00(根据您的需要)。
  6. 单击“确定”。

四、应用条件格式

条件格式允许您根据特定条件更改单元格的格式。可以设置条件格式,使满足条件的单元格自动显示负号。

设置条件格式的步骤:

  1. 选中需要添加负号的单元格或区域。
  2. 选择“开始”选项卡,然后单击“条件格式”。
  3. 选择“新建规则”。
  4. 选择“使用公式确定要设置格式的单元格”。
  5. 在公式框中输入条件公式,例如 =A1>0
  6. 单击“格式”,选择“数字”选项卡。
  7. 选择“自定义”,输入 -0-0.00
  8. 单击“确定”,然后再次单击“确定”。

五、VBA脚本

如果您需要更灵活的处理,可以使用VBA脚本来批量添加负号。以下是一个简单的VBA脚本示例:

Sub AddNegativeSign()

Dim cell As Range

For Each cell In Selection

If IsNumeric(cell.Value) And cell.Value > 0 Then

cell.Value = -cell.Value

End If

Next cell

End Sub

使用VBA脚本的步骤:

  1. Alt + F11 打开VBA编辑器。
  2. 插入一个新模块。
  3. 将上述代码粘贴到模块中。
  4. 关闭VBA编辑器。
  5. 选中需要添加负号的单元格区域。
  6. Alt + F8,选择“AddNegativeSign”宏运行。

以上几种方法都可以在Excel中有效地添加负号。根据实际需求选择最适合的方法,可以大大提高工作效率。

相关问答FAQs:

1. 为什么我的Excel单元格中输入负号后,数字没有变成负数?
在Excel中,如果要在单元格中输入负号,需要使用特殊的格式化方式才能实现。负号在Excel中默认是作为减号处理的,如果直接输入负号,Excel会将其视为减法运算符。要在单元格中输入负号,可以在数字前面加上单引号('),或者使用文本格式(在单元格格式中选择文本格式)。

2. 如何在Excel中显示带有负号的数值,并进行计算?
在Excel中,如果想要显示带有负号的数值,并进行计算,可以使用负数格式。选中需要显示负号的单元格,然后在菜单栏中选择“格式”>“单元格”,在“数字”选项卡中选择“负数”分类,选择相应的负数格式,例如“-1234”或“1234-”。

3. 如何在Excel中实现负数以括号的形式显示?
在Excel中,可以通过自定义格式来实现负数以括号的形式显示。选中需要显示负数的单元格,然后在菜单栏中选择“格式”>“单元格”,在“数字”选项卡中选择“自定义”分类,然后在“类型”框中输入以下格式代码:0.00;(0.00),点击“确定”即可实现负数以括号的形式显示。

文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4431638

(0)
Edit1Edit1
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部